JavaScript 如何通过基本工资计算并打印奖金和总收入
在本文中,我们将学习如何创建一个JavaScript程序,该程序将要求用户输入他们的基本工资,然后计算奖金金额,即基本工资或底薪的20%。总收入是奖金金额加上基本工资。
bonus amount = 20% of basic salary
gross salary = bonus amount + basic salary
方法: 在这段代码中,我们将显示一个输入框给用户,提示用户输入基本工资。点击提交按钮后,将调用计算函数,计算奖金金额和总金额,并使用JavaScript中的DOM元素将其显示给用户。
示例:
Input 1: 50000
Output:
Bonus: 10000
Gross: 60000
Input 2: 2500
Output:
Bonus: 500
Gross: 3000
Input 3: 32500
Output:
Bonus: 6500
Gross: 39000
以下是上述方法的实现。
Javascript
<script>
(function calculate() {
var bpay, bonus, gross;
bpay = 50000;
//bonus is 20% of basic salary
bonus = 0.2 * bpay;
gross = bonus + bpay;
console.log("Basic Pay: " + bpay);
console.log("Bonus: " + bonus);
console.log("Gross: " + gross);
})();
</script>
输出:
Basic Pay: 50000
Bonus: 10000
Gross: 60000